Rebuilding Britain: A Survey Of Problems Of Reconstruction After The World War (1918) is a book written by Alfred Hopkinson. The book provides a comprehensive analysis of the challenges faced by Britain in the aftermath of World War I. It examines the impact of the war on the country’s economy, society, and political structure, and discusses the measures that need to be taken to rebuild the nation.Hopkinson’s book is divided into several chapters, each of which deals with a specific aspect of the reconstruction process. The first chapter provides an overview of the problems faced by Britain after the war, including the massive debt incurred during the conflict and the need to rebuild the country’s infrastructure. The subsequent chapters delve deeper into these issues, exploring the challenges faced by different sectors of society, such as the working class, farmers, and women.The book also discusses the role of the government in the reconstruction process, examining the policies and programs that were put in place to address the challenges facing the country. Hopkinson argues that the government must take an active role in rebuilding Britain, providing support and assistance to those who have been affected by the war.Overall, Rebuilding Britain: A Survey Of Problems Of Reconstruction After The World War (1918) is a comprehensive and insightful analysis of the challenges faced by Britain in the aftermath of World War I.
